 Obituario de William Francis Bertolasio
William Francis Bertolasio, 93, died of natural causes May 15, 2022, at home with family & friends. He was born on November 2, 1928, in Jerome (Johnstown), Pennsylvania. Bill served in the United States Marine Corps and retired with honors as a Gunnery Sergeant after 21 years of service. He went on to earn his undergraduate degree from Hampton University and a master’s degree from Virginia Tech. After the military, Bill taught industrial arts and coached track & field at various schools including Garfield High School, Potomac High School, and Graham Park Middle School. He was married to Eleanor (Honey) Anne Ehrhardt for 43 years, who went home to be with the Lord in 1996. He then married EJ Strode and was married another 22 years. Bill was a member of William of York Catholic Church in Stafford, VA & St. Patrick's Catholic Church in Spotsylvania, VA. Bill is a lifetime member of the Marine Corp League and over the years a member of the American Legion. Some of his favorite times included playing poker with family or on the machines in Vegas. He found a love for ballroom dancing after retiring from teaching and we will not forget his fishing trips to Alaska, once sending home a 115lb Halibut. He was predeceased by his wives Eleanor Bertolasio & EJ Bertolasio, son Mark Bertolasio, and three sisters, Roberta, Jeannie, and Nancy.
